Duties
Understand completely all policies, procedures, standards, specifications, guidelines, and training programs.
Ensure that all guests feel welcome and are given responsive, friendly, and courteous service at all times.
Ensure that all food and products are consistently prepared and served according to the restaurant’s recipes, portioning, cooking, and serving standards.
Achieve company objectives in sales, service, quality, the appearance of facility and sanitation and cleanliness through training of associates and creating a positive, productive working environment.
Checks side work completion prior to opening and before closing.
Administer corrective action as necessary consulting/communicating with Restaurant Manager or Food & Beverage Director as necessary. Ensure that Human Resources management approves any discharges.
Maintain a presence on the floor during hours of operation.
Must have or obtain current TAPS and Alaska Food Handler or ServSafe certifications.
Fill in where needed to ensure guest service standards and efficient operations.
Continually strengthen staff in all areas of professional development.
Prepare all required paperwork, including forms, reports, and schedules in an organized and timely manner.
Ensure that all equipment is kept clean and kept in excellent working condition through personal inspection and by following the restaurant’s preventative maintenance programs.
Ensure that all products are received in correct unit count and condition and that deliveries are performed in accordance with the restaurant’s receiving policies and procedures.
Oversee and ensure that restaurant policies on associate performance appraisals are followed and completed on a timely basis.
Schedule labor as required by anticipated business activity while ensuring that all positions are staffed as needed and that labor cost objectives are met.
Complete daily food and beverage/event reports and necessary paperwork.
Be knowledgeable of restaurant policies regarding personnel and administer prompt, fair, and consistent corrective action for any and all violations of company policies, rules, and procedures.
Fully understand and comply with all federal, state, county, and municipal regulations that pertain to health, safety, and labor requirements of the restaurant, associates, and guests.
